Kentucky was a key gateway to westward expansion. Many people will discover as they pursue their genealogy an ancestor or two who once called Kentucky home. The records preserved as part of the State Archives at the Kentucky Department for Libraries and Archives can prove to be a vital resource in tracing those Bluegrass Roots. Attendees of this event will learn about the various local and state records that make up the collections of the State Archives the value they have for the genealogist and how they can access them.

Rusty Heckaman is the Research Room Supervisor of the Kentucky Department for Libraries and Archives. There he manages KDLA’s Archives Research Room staff, coordinating research and reference assistance for in-person and off-site customers; appraises, arranges, describes and indexes public records from state and local government agencies; and represents KDLA in public presentations about the discoveries waiting to be made in the State Archives collections and their unique uses for researchers.
